XOM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2018 in Review

2,425 of the 4,375 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in ExxonMobil (XOM) for Q3 2018, worth a combined $196B — up 4.6% from $188B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 68 funds opened new XOM positions and 56 closed out — a net gain of 12 holders — while 825 added to existing stakes and 1,262 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Wellington Management Group, adding an estimated $1.63B. The largest seller was Mitsubishi UFJ Trust & Banking, cutting an estimated $444M.
